Some three
years ago the Club decided to build a new “N” gauge layout, Rugby
Central. This is the smaller of Rugby’s two stations, the one on the
old Great Central line. It will be as it was in the early 60’s, shortly
before the whole of the line was closed. Photos, plans & maps were
gathered together and layout plans drawn. With a little bit of
“modellers licence” we will have a scale model of the Station, sidings
& immediate area. It is a continuous track and the total board
length of 16 feet will allow us to run full length trains.
Boards were constructed and trackwork laid. We “jury rigged” the wiring
and the very basic layout was shown at TaDRail 2009.
After some delay due to a move to new Club premises we started work
again, mainly on the electrics. There will be three controllers – Up
Main, Down Main & Goods Yard. These will be interlinked, with all
points and signals interlocked. As will be seen from the Photograph of
one of the four boards it is a little complicated. (well it is to me)
Some of the buildings have been completed and some scenic work started.
The rather complex Station building is “in construction”
The electrics should be completed fairly soon – then we start all the
testing! Once any snags have been dealt with (we have total faith in or
electrics team so there shouldn’t be any!!!!) the scenics should move
along quite quickly.
